Understanding the .308 Winchester Cartridge and Barrel Length

The .308 Winchester, or 7.62x51mm NATO, is a versatile and widely popular cartridge known for its accuracy and stopping power. Its effectiveness stems from a delicate balance of powder charge, bullet weight, and barrel length. The barrel length plays a crucial role in determining the velocity of the bullet, which directly impacts its trajectory, energy, and effective range. A longer barrel allows for more complete powder combustion, theoretically leading to higher velocities. However, this isn’t always a linear relationship, and other factors come into play.

The Science of Internal Ballistics

Internal ballistics, the study of what happens inside the barrel when a firearm is discharged, dictates how efficiently the powder charge converts into kinetic energy propelling the bullet. The .308 cartridge is designed to burn its propellant within a specific barrel length range. If the barrel is too short, the powder may not completely burn, resulting in unburnt powder exiting the muzzle (muzzle flash) and a loss of velocity. Conversely, while a longer barrel theoretically allows for more complete combustion, it can reach a point of diminishing returns where the added friction slows the bullet down. Finding the sweet spot is key.

Factors Affecting Optimal Barrel Length

Several factors influence the optimal barrel length for a .308 rifle:

* **Intended Use:** Hunting, target shooting, tactical applications, and long-range precision shooting all have different requirements. A shorter barrel might be preferable for maneuverability in close quarters, while a longer barrel is often favored for maximizing velocity at long distances.
* **Bullet Weight:** Heavier bullets typically benefit from longer barrels to achieve optimal velocity.
* **Powder Type:** Different powders have different burn rates. Some powders are designed to burn quickly, making them suitable for shorter barrels, while others are slower-burning and require longer barrels to reach their full potential.
* **Suppressor Use:** If you plan to use a suppressor, consider the added length. A shorter barrel might be necessary to keep the overall length manageable.

308 Barrel Length Chart: Velocity and Performance

Below is a general guideline for .308 barrel length and its approximate impact on muzzle velocity. Note that these numbers can vary depending on the specific ammunition, rifle, and environmental conditions. This **308 barrel length chart** provides a general overview and serves as a starting point for your research.

| Barrel Length (inches) | Approximate Muzzle Velocity (fps) | General Application |
| :——————— | :———————————- | :—————————————————- |
| 16″ | 2600-2700 | CQB, Hunting (short to medium range), Lightweight Builds |
| 18″ | 2700-2800 | Hunting (medium range), Tactical Rifles |
| 20″ | 2800-2900 | Hunting (medium to long range), Precision Shooting |
| 22″ | 2900-3000 | Hunting (long range), Precision Shooting |
| 24″ | 3000+ | Long Range Precision, Target Shooting |

*Disclaimer: These velocities are estimates and can vary significantly.*

Analyzing the 308 Barrel Length Chart

As the **308 barrel length chart** illustrates, there’s a noticeable increase in velocity as barrel length increases. However, the velocity gains become less significant with each additional inch. The difference between a 16″ and 18″ barrel is typically more pronounced than the difference between a 22″ and 24″ barrel. This is due to the diminishing returns mentioned earlier.

Insightful Q&A Section

Here are some frequently asked questions about .308 barrel length and performance:

1. **What is the shortest barrel length recommended for a .308 rifle?**

The shortest recommended barrel length for a .308 rifle is typically 16 inches. While shorter barrels are possible, they can result in significant velocity loss and increased muzzle flash. A 16-inch barrel provides a good balance between maneuverability and performance for most applications.
2. **Does a longer barrel always mean better accuracy in a .308?**

Not necessarily. While a longer barrel can potentially increase velocity and improve long-range performance, it doesn’t automatically guarantee better accuracy. Barrel quality, chamber dimensions, and rifling quality are all crucial factors that contribute to accuracy. A high-quality barrel of any length will generally outperform a poorly made longer barrel.
3. **How does barrel twist rate affect bullet stability in a .308?**

Barrel twist rate refers to the number of inches it takes for the rifling to make one complete revolution. A faster twist rate (e.g., 1:10) is better suited for stabilizing heavier bullets, while a slower twist rate (e.g., 1:12) is better suited for lighter bullets. Choosing the appropriate twist rate for your chosen bullet weight is essential for achieving optimal accuracy.
4. **What is the ideal barrel length for hunting deer with a .308?**

The ideal barrel length for hunting deer with a .308 depends on the hunting environment. In dense brush, a shorter barrel (16-18 inches) is preferable for maneuverability. In open terrain, a longer barrel (20-22 inches) can provide increased velocity and extended range. A 20-inch barrel is a good compromise for most deer hunting situations.
5. **How does suppressor use impact the optimal .308 barrel length?**

When using a suppressor, it’s often desirable to use a shorter barrel to keep the overall length of the rifle manageable. A 16-inch barrel with a suppressor is often comparable in length to a 20-inch barrel without a suppressor. Consider the added length of the suppressor when choosing your barrel length.
6. **What is the effect of barrel harmonics on .308 accuracy?**

Barrel harmonics refer to the vibrations that occur in the barrel when a firearm is discharged. These vibrations can affect accuracy, especially at longer ranges. Properly bedding the action and using a free-floating barrel can help to minimize the effects of barrel harmonics.
7. **Can I improve the accuracy of my .308 rifle by upgrading the barrel?**

Yes, upgrading the barrel is one of the most effective ways to improve the accuracy of a .308 rifle. A high-quality aftermarket barrel with a match-grade chamber and precision rifling can significantly enhance accuracy potential.
8. **How often should I replace my .308 barrel?**

The lifespan of a .308 barrel depends on several factors, including the type of ammunition used, the frequency of shooting, and the level of maintenance. Generally, a .308 barrel can last for several thousand rounds before accuracy starts to degrade. Signs that a barrel needs to be replaced include excessive throat erosion, reduced accuracy, and difficulty cleaning.
9. **What are the key differences between chrome-lined and stainless steel .308 barrels?**

Chrome-lined barrels are more resistant to corrosion and wear, making them a good choice for high-volume shooting or harsh environmental conditions. Stainless steel barrels are generally more accurate but less resistant to corrosion and wear. The choice between the two depends on your specific needs and priorities.
10. **How important is barrel break-in for a new .308 barrel?**

Barrel break-in is a process of gradually firing and cleaning a new barrel to smooth out any imperfections and improve accuracy. While the effectiveness of barrel break-in is debated, many shooters believe that it can help to extend barrel life and improve accuracy. A typical break-in procedure involves firing a few rounds, cleaning the barrel thoroughly, and repeating the process several times.
